NBL1 Wildcard Recap | Round 11 Thursday

In a nail-bitter NBL1 Wildcard game, Basketball Australia’s Centre of Excellence Women’s squad beat the Willetton Tigers 75-72, off the back of CoE star Isobel Borlase’s fourth-quarter performance.
She had 11 points and two steals alone in the fourth quarter, which completely flipped the game in favour of the now 7-4 squad. She finished the game with 18 points and six rebounds, while star teammate Nyadiew Puoch had a double-double with 10 points and 10 rebounds.
Willetton did not disappoint as the Footlocker Player of the Week Alex Sharp put up 25 points, eight rebounds and four assists in the close Thursday night clash.
The Tigers are third on the NBL1 West ladder and looked like the better team for most of the game, with the CoE only leading by two at the half. But the veteran Tigers weren’t a match for Borlase’s fourth quarter.
The Women’s CoE has plenty of more games coming up as on Saturday they’ll face the 16-1 Joondalup Wolves. Then they will head up to Queensland to face the undefeated Logan Thunder on Monday and the 15-2 Southern District Spartans on Tuesday.
